I've heard very good things about Bavarian Soundwerks' upgrade kits.
http://www.bavariansoundwerks.com/ Although they don't yet have products for the F10, they are in the works and will definitely be coming at some point. To get an idea, you can look at the E60 speaker upgrade kit they offer as well as the amplifier upgrade. The speaker kits are drop-in upgrades and are very easy to install. |

If you replace the speakers you risk messing up the Dirac optimization which could result in worse frequency response, stereo perception and other things you have payed for, having the Hifi professional upgrade.
Couldn't find a good summary of the technology, but here's a pressrelease from Dirac/Bentley that applies to BMW as well. http://www.dirac.se/news.asp?newsItem=1803 |
